Toronto, Ontario, February 14, 2011—Distribution360 today announced it has acquired rights to distribute the Cartoon Network U.K. version of Skatoony to French and German-speaking Europe as well as Spain. The company will also distribute the North American version of Skatoony—produced by marblemedia—to the same territories. Skatoony (U.K.) airs on Cartoon Network U.K.; Skatoony (North America) was commissioned by TELETOON, and premiered on the Canadian kids network in English and French this past October. Skatoony is the first animated/live-action quiz show adventure that pits tweens and ‘toons against each other in four frantic, trivia-based rounds. Set in a fantastical television studio in the fictional town of Showtown, the series is anchored by the cartoon duo of host Chudd Chudders and his lounge-singing sidekick, The Earl. Each week, they attempt to put together another show, while all manner of mad happenings occur around them. Skatoony Interactive features the “Skatoony Home Game,” a multi-player game where kids play Skatoony in real-time against other kids online.

About Distribution360 Distribution360 is a forward-thinking distribution company that focuses on traditional media sales, while actively pursuing growth in the digital space, and offers value added Brand Integration and Interactive Content Creation Services. Its mandate is the full monetization of television and interactive content on traditional and emerging platforms worldwide, with a focus on kids, drama and factual programming. Based in Europe, Stéphanie Röckmann-Portier leads Distribution360’s daily operations as Managing Director/Head of Sales. She brings 15 years of international content experience acquired through her previous roles as VP of Content Strategy & Acquisitions for online video service Joost, and VP of International Sales and Head of Factual Programming for Alliance Atlantis Communications Inc. Distribution360 was co-founded by two of Canada’s foremost production companies: marblemedia and SEVEN24 Films.
